O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S RH 200 Operation

Cornering

To take a right-hand corner forwards depress only pedal(112, Fig. 2-84:) forwards

To take a lefthand corner forwardsdepress only pedal (113) forwards -

Turning

To turn to the right depress pedal (112) forwards and pedal (113) backwards

To turn to the left depress pedal (113) forwards and pedal (112) backwards.

Never use the working equipment to raise one side of the undercarriage and then turn the undercarriage by initiating the slewing and/or the travelling function.

This way of working is contrary to the excavator'sdesignated use.

There is a risk of accident. Moreover, the tracks, slewing gear, roller bearing slewing ring, backhoe or bucket back-wall and the front part of the bukket are subjected to inadmissibly high stresses.

Note

Change the position of the undercarriage - parallel or perpendicular to the working face - only by cornering forwards/backwards (Fig. 2-85:).

Cornering to the left: forwards from pos. 1 to pos. 2 backwards from pos. 2 to pos. 3 forwards from pos. 3 to pos. 4

The same procedure should be adopted if the excavator is to be driven out of depressions (Fig. 2-86:):

Cornering to the left from pos. 1 to pos. 2

Cornering to the right from pos. 2 to pos. 3
